Overview

The Store Manager in Training (SMIT) role is a developmental position designed to prepare future Store Managers within our Dunkin' network. SMITs receive comprehensive, hands‑on training across all store functions and leadership levels. Once trained, SMITs support various locations across the network until a Store Manager (SM) position becomes available. In the absence of a Store Manager, the SMIT fulfills all responsibilities of the role, driving daily operations, supporting team development, and ensuring brand and operational excellence.

This is a structured training position designed to develop future Store Managers by focusing on the individual’s growth, the improvement of store operations, and the development of people across the network. The SMIT plays a critical support role in store execution and leadership, helping strengthen team performance while preparing to take on full store management responsibilities. This role reports directly to the District Manager and is a key part of our leadership pipeline.
